This is a opportunity to see the process normally hidden in the solitary pursuit of creating this artwork.
You will find oil paintings starting from a blank gessoed panel to the finished oil on panel painting and an engraving in the process of being printed, from the engraved metal plate and blank sheets of paper, to the finished print.
More slide shows will be added in the future as new artwork is created.
We hope you enjoy this chance to peek over the shoulder of the artist in the act of creation.
